    • PROBLEM TO BE SOLVED: To prevent improper operation when using a reinforcing bar binding machine in low temperature environment.
      SOLUTION: This reinforcing bar binding machine is provided with a control means for reading a set position of a motor driving adjusting dial and a condition of a trigger lever when turning on a power supply switch and driving a binding wire cutting mechanism for predetermined number of times when the motor driving adjusting dial is at a specific set position and the trigger lever is on for warming-up. By performing warming-up operation in cold environment, viscosity of grease applied on a mechanism part is reduced to perform work in the same way as warm environment without wasting a binding wire.

    • PROBLEM TO BE SOLVED: To provide an inexpensive reinforcing-bar binder of a simple structure, which surely identifies a type of a wire reel and can automatically adjust a feeding quantity of the wire wound around the wire reel or a torsional torque.
      SOLUTION: The reinforcing-bar binder 1 is to feed a wire 8 by rotating the wire reel 30 loaded in a storage chamber 70 to bind reinforcing bars 3. In the storage chamber 70, a first detecting means 80 for detecting a rotation quantity of the wire reel 30 and a second detecting means 25 for detecting the number of the second detected part 53 of the wire reel 30 over the rotation quantity detected by the first detecting means 80 are provided. The binder body 2 is provided with a controlling means for controlling the feeding quantity of the wire 8 and the torsional torque of the wire 8 according to the number of the second detected part 53 detected by the second detecting means 25.

    • PROBLEM TO BE SOLVED: To improve the binding finish in a reinforcement binding machine.
      SOLUTION: A binding wire clamp device 1 is installed on the tip of a rotational driving shaft, and is composed of three clamp plates 2, 3, and 4, and a sleeve 5. Groove cams 9 and 10 formed on the left and right clamp plates 3, and 4 are engaged with guide pins 11, and 12 of the sleeve 5. A binding wire is sent out upward through a part between the left clamp plate 4 and the central clamp plate 2 by a binding wire feeding mechanism. The tip of the binding wire formed in a loop shape by a circular arc-shaped nose enters between the right clamp plate 3 and the central clamp plate 2 from below, and stops by touching an upper stopper part 14 of the right clamp plate. The left and right clamp plates close by advancing the sleeve, and clamp the binding wire, and cut a rear end part by pulling back an excess quantity of the binding wire. The binding wire clamp device rotates, and binds reinforcements.

    • PROBLEM TO BE SOLVED: To improve the finish of binding in a reinforceing bar-binding machine.
      SOLUTION: A binding wire-clamping device 13 with three clamping plates 14, 15, and 16 at the front end of a ball screw shaft driven by a motor. Right and left clamping plates 15 and 16 are brought into elastic contact with a central clamping plate 14 by a spring 33, and the right and left clamping plates are made to close by the action of cams 27 and 28 when retracting a sleeve. In an opened state of the clamping plates, binding wire is fed upward passing between the clamping plate 15 and the central clamping plate 14, formed into a loop shape, and inserted between the left clamping plate 16 and the central clamping plate 14. When the ball screw shaft is rotatably driven to retract the sleeve, the right and left clamping plates are closed, and after holding the front end and rear end of the binding wire loop the binding wire-clamping device is rotated to twist the binding wire, so that the reinforcing bars are bound.

    • PROBLEM TO BE SOLVED: To enhance the stability of binding strength of a reinforcing-bar binding machine.
      SOLUTION: A final gear 23 and a ball screw shaft 24 of a rotary drive system of a binding-wire twisting mechanism are coupled together by a spline, and a shaft part of a central clamp plate 26 of a binding-wire clamping device 25 is coupled to an end of the shaft 24. A shift mechanism is provided to make the shaft 24 and the device 25 moved forward/backward by means of a slide motor 22. A binding-wire feeding mechanism makes a wire W wound around a reinforcing bar S; the wire W is held by an end of the device 25; and after that, the shift mechanism makes the device 25 retreat so as to impart a tension to a wire loop. A twisting motor 21 makes the device 25 rotated, and the shift mechanism makes the device 25 advance to make the wire W twisted. Twisting of the wire W under the tension stabilizes the reinforcing-bar binding strength of the wire loop.

    • A rechargeable electric tool includes a warning device which monitors a voltage of a power source battery and indicates a warning by means of an LED or a buzzer when the power source voltage is reduced to be equal to or lower than a reference voltage. The tool is configured such that, even when the warning is indicated, a control to interrupt a power supply to a motor is not performed, thereby enabling a usual operation in response to an activating operation on a trigger switch. Thus, an operation can be carried out even when the warning is indicated by a voltage reduction under a low temperature, and usability and working efficiency are improved as compared with a configuration where the power supply to the motor is interrupted at the time when the warning is indicated. Moreover, in a case where it is determined that a memory effect is generated in the battery, the activating operation can be repeated until the activation of the motor is disabled after voltage warning, whereby the battery can be fully discharged to a level equal to or lower than a discharge end voltage to eliminate the memory effect.

    • A twisting shaft 33 and a remover 34 fitted around the twisting shaft 33 are provided with forks 37, 44 at their respective front portions, and hooks 38 bent from front ends of the forks of the twisting shaft in the forward rotational direction are provided. The remover is rotatable by a one-way stopper mechanism in the forward direction only. When the twisting shaft and remover are rotated forward, a binding wire loop is hung on the hooks 38 and twisted. When the twisting shaft is reversely rotated after the completion of the twisting operation, the remover stops being rotated by the one-way stopper mechanism, and the twisting shaft alone is reversely rotated. As a result, the hooks 38 hide themselves behind the forks 44 of the remover 34, and the binding wire engaged with the hooks 38 is pressed by the forks 44 and removed.
